Question Dash warning lights stay on: Why?

All warning lights on dash stay illuminated when car is started. Car is 1992 300E.

What is potential problem?

Doubt it..
Check for voltage at the 3 wire connector on firewall, behind brake booster..Red/Blk/Yellow.
You should have 12v across R/B and low volts [3-8] across Y/B.. That will verify ACC and fuses..
Thst is power feed for blower/regulator..
